The International Economic Development Council (IEDC) and the International City/County Managers Association(ICMA) have developed a training course in partnership with FEMA: “Planning for Economic Recovery.” Filled with examples of successful economic recovery strategies, this interactive webinar offers opportunities for small group discussions and peer learning.
